We’re looking for an experienced and enthusiastic Chef de Partie to join our well-established kitchen team at The Mandolay Hotel in Guildford. The Mandolay is a busy four-star hotel with a one AA Rosette restaurant, a strong reputation for quality food and extensive conference, wedding and banqueting facilities. This is a varied role offering the opportunity to work across restaurant service, private dining and large-scale events.

The role:

  • Full-time, permanent position
  • 40 hours per week
  • Five days over seven
  • £19.00 per hour, including holiday pay
  • Paid overtime at the same hourly rate
  • A varied mix of restaurant and banqueting work

What we’re looking for:

  • You’ll have previous experience working as a Chef de Partie or an experienced Demi Chef de Partie ready to take the next step.
  • You should be passionate about producing high-quality food, comfortable working in a busy kitchen and able to maintain excellent standards during both restaurant and large banqueting services.
  • You’ll need to be reliable, organised and able to work well as part of an established team.
